Wanted to check and see if anyone else is having this issue.

Earlier last night, I was running my toons and had a couple crash. When I tried to log them in again via the RedGuides launcher, it said "This account needs to be active in order to play" or something along those lines. I subsequently lost access to all of my accounts in the same way.

When I try to log them in directly via the Launcher, it just says there was an error completing my request and to try again later. When I try to login to the EQ website, it says Invalid credentials for all my accounts.

No messages, no e-mails or anything about a suspension/ban, but obviously that is my main concern. Is anybody else having or has had a similar issue? Hoping all my accounts didn't just get taken out, but I'm not sure. Even had one account hit that I only play on TLP and that has never had MQ loaded.

If you have any idea what might be going on, let me know! Thanks.

Hmm...what is a hardware ID ban? Is that different than an IP ban?
 
Hmm...what is a hardware ID ban? Is that different than an IP ban?
Ya bascially links all your shit together based on your hardware ID hash on your current PC. IP can be bypassed by vpns etc. So basically anytime you sign into an account now it'll ban it and give you that error. In a nutshell they use it to get rid of people they've been watching a long time and are certain they don't want back. If this happens to be your case based on what the GM says or w/e, they'll watch you, any krono trades, transfers, things that are documentable. So once you move something like kronos to another account on a fresh thing that'll be banned as well. This may not be your case I don't know, but if it is, they'll come down hard more than likely.
